Creating filters

You can determine which emails are forwarded

to your Nokia device by creating filters:
1 Click the Filters tab.
2 Click

New.

3 In the

Filter Name field, enter a descriptive

name for the filter.

4 In any of the

From, Sent to, Subject, Body,

Recipient Types, Sensitivity, and Importance

fields, enter the properties that you want the

filter to use. Separate multiple entries with a

semicolon (;).

5 To forward emails detected by the filter to your

Nokia device, select

Forward message to the

handset. To leave the detected emails on the

server, select

Don't forward message to the

handset.

6 Click

OK.

Filters are used in the order that they are listed

on the Filters tab.
To move a filter, select the filter you want to

move and use the arrows to the right of the filter

to move the filter to the position you want.
To disable a filter, clear the check box next to it.

Creating an encryption key

An encryption key is used to protect your emails

while they travel between the BlackBerry

Enterprise Server and your Nokia device.
To create an encryption key, click the Security tab

and select one of the following:

Generate keys automatically. BlackBerry

Connect Desktop will remind you to generate a

new encryption key when needed. When

prompted, move your mouse on the screen to

generate the key.

Generate keys manually. BlackBerry Connect

Desktop will not remind you to generate a new

encryption key.

To generate a new encryption key at any time,

click

Generate, and move your mouse on the

screen.

Setting advanced options

In the Advanced tab, you can specify the email

address you want to use, select an email profile,

select folders to redirect emails from, and specify

if you want to save copies of the emails you have

sent.
